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.11.21;
Скачать: CL | DM;

Вниз

колонка типа TdxDBGridButtonColumn какая кнопка нажата   Найти похожие ветки 

 
Ivan_   (2004-10-22 17:28) [0]

В гриде колонка типа TdxDBGridButtonColumn добавил туда вторую кнопку. Как определить какая из них нажата я написал что то типа if (grdServiceFullName.Buttons[1].????) незнаю или есть другой вариант?


 
stud ©   (2004-10-22 17:54) [1]

а если вроде
if (sender as...).name="" then ...?


 
Ivan_   (2004-10-22 18:02) [2]

Да так намного лучьше но чуму оно рвно if (Sender as TdxDBGridButtonColumn).Buttons[1] = "")   ?? Это ведь тип TdxEditButton


 
stud ©   (2004-10-22 18:06) [3]

а чему оно может быть равно???
ты отлавливаеш sender и смотриш его имя.у твоих кнопок имя есть? вот в зависимости от имени сендера и выполняеш действия


 
stud ©   (2004-10-22 18:07) [4]

погоди..


 
stud ©   (2004-10-22 18:14) [5]

вот это тебе наверное нужно?

procedure TForm1.dxDBGrid1Column4ButtonClick(Sender: TObject;
 AbsoluteIndex: Integer);
begin
 label1.Caption:=inttostr(AbsoluteIndex);

end;

если версии гидов у нас одинаковые


 
vuk ©   (2004-10-22 18:15) [6]

TdxDBTreeListButtonColumn.OnButtonClick

type
 TdxEditButtonClickEvent = procedure (Sender: TObject; AbsoluteIndex: Integer) of object;
property OnButtonClick: TdxEditButtonClickEvent;

Description
Write an OnButtonClick event handler to perform specific actions when clicking a button within a cell.  The AbsoluteIndex parameter determines the index of the pressed button.  This index is zero-based.


 
Ivan_   (2004-10-22 18:25) [7]

Да! супер спасибо! Буду учиться хелп читать :-))



Страницы: 1 вся ветка

Текущий архив: 2004.11.21;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.042 c
11-1082741850
Max003
2004-04-23 21:37
2004.11.21
Почему MCK проекты не работают под Windows98 !!!


14-1099569798
1C
2004-11-04 15:03
2004.11.21
Подключить принтер к 1С


3-1098104727
Andrushk
2004-10-18 17:05
2004.11.21
Как восстановить связь с базой?


1-1099171874
blast
2004-10-31 01:31
2004.11.21
TreeView. Нужно, чтобы по DblClick узел не разворачивался...


1-1099510216
tormoz
2004-11-03 22:30
2004.11.21
Работа с Word (туда и обратно)